4. Home to Iconic American Cuisine
Texas’s culinary traditions, including barbecue, Tex-Mex, and chili, have significantly influenced American cuisine. The state’s barbecue culture, characterized by slow-smoked meats, has become a national favorite. Tex-Mex cuisine, blending Mexican and American flavors, offers dishes like fajitas and enchiladas that are now staples across the U.S. Chili, often associated with Texas, is a hearty stew that has inspired countless regional variations. These foods reflect the state’s rich cultural heritage and its impact on the broader American food landscape (Texasmonthly.com).
